A leading Independent IT Infrastructure and Services Consultancy are looking for a Junior-Mid level Scrum Master to support an internal Agile transformation programme.


Based in Hatfield (Hybrid 2/3 days per week)

Inside IR35

Up to £300 per day

To start ASAP


The Scrum Master will remove day‑to‑day impediments, encourage continuous improvement, and promote healthy team collaboration.

To support delivery teams by facilitating Agile ceremonies, helping the team maintain focus, and ensuring steady progress toward sprint goals.


Scope & Context

Working with one cross‑functional Scrum team.

Supporting delivery of defined backlog items with limited cross‑team dependencies.

Encouraging good Agile practices appropriate to the team’s maturity level.


Experience & Knowledge

2-3 years’ experience as a Scrum Master or Agile team facilitator/ enabler in an IT delivery environment.

Working knowledge of Scrum and/or Kanban practices.

Familiar with basic software delivery processes (requirements, development, testing).

Comfortable using tools such as Jira/Azure DevOps, Confluence, MS Teams, or Miro.

Core Skills & Behaviours

Strong communication and facilitation skills.

Collaborative and supportive team‑focused mindset.

Good problem‑solving skills and willingness to escalate issues appropriately.

Ability to maintain team focus and encourage positive delivery habits


Qualifications

Scrum Master certifications (PSM I, CSM or equivalent) desirable but not essential.


Key Accountabilities

Team Facilitation & Support

Facilitate team ceremonies (Daily Stand‑ups, Sprint Planning, Reviews, Retrospectives).

Help the team maintain commitment to sprint goals and deliver planned work.

Identify and remove day‑to‑day blockers affecting the team.

Assist the Product Owner with maintaining a healthy and prioritised backlog.

Stakeholder Collaboration

Support clear communication between the team and stakeholders.

Ensure visibility of sprint progress, team capacity, and impediments.

Continuous Improvement

Promote a culture of continuous improvement within the team.

Encourage feedback, experimentation, and small incremental changes.

Support the team in applying good Agile practices (definition of ready/done, basic quality focus).


Key Deliverables / Outcomes

Consistent, well‑run Agile ceremonies.

Clear visibility of team progress and impediments.

Improved team collaboration and engagement.

Steady and reliable delivery of sprint commitments.

Incremental improvement actions captured and implemented.

Raising delivery standards, improving predictability, embedding continuous improvement and supporting cross‑team alignment at scale

Clear tracking of impediments and faster removal of recurring day‑to‑day blockers.

Positive feedback from team and Product Owner on clarity and team flow.
